Our analysis found Utah Valley University to be the most popular school for accounting students who want to pursue a undergraduate certificate in Utah. Located in the city of Orem, UVU is a public college with a fairly large student population.
Women make up 25% of the accounting majors at the school.

A rank of #2 on this year’s list means Salt Lake Community College is a great place for accounting students working on their undergraduate certificate. Located in the large suburb of Salt Lake City, Salt Lake Community College is a public college with a fairly large student population.
Of the 7 students majoring in accounting at Salt Lake Community College, 29% are male and 71% are female.
